Abstract:Under three level of applications of nitrogen fertilizer, six Japanese differential strains of Piricularia oryzae were used to inoculate twelve Japanese singal-gene differential varieties respectively. According to the changes of type and number of lesion, the effect of different applications of nitrogen fertilizer on vertical resistance of rice varieties was tested. The result indicates that with the increase of applications of nitrogen fertilizer, the number of susceptible type which increased lesions, in the number of accounted for 6.9% the types of lesions changing from resistance to susceptibility accounts for 23.6% of total, of which, 13.9% became susceptible ones in mid-lever application of nitrogen fertilizer, and 9.7% in high-level application of nitrogen fertilizer. Thus it can be seen that the vertical resistance of some rice varieties is affected by applications of nitrogen fertilizer, and some of them are more sensitive to nitrogen fertilizer.
